    ECBOT down today - did you get stuck in the YM?

    The ECBOT was down today from about 11:15 to 12:10 PST. Of course, the Dow did a 180 the moment the exchange went down and started squeezing those short the YM, with no way for them to get out of their positions. This reminded me of May 2003 when the globex went down and I was short the ES...

    How does IB implement a simulated stop order on Globex?

    From what I have read Globex accepts STOP LIMIT orders only. IB simulates the STOP (market) order. How does IB implement this? Is any part of the order submitted to the exchange before the trigger? I am interested in the ES and ER2 futures products.

    Canadian Traders (What currency?)

    As a Canadian with a $US account you are essentially long the USD/CAD by an amount equal to your account balance. If you wish to hedge your currency risk, buy one CAD (CME globex) future for every ~90K $US in your account. Now, if the CAD goes back down to $0.65, you'll be wishing you had never...

    How would you test for trendiness?

    The SMA(200) of ADX(14) series would measure this. Markets with a higher value would be more "trendy" (over the last year) in this respect.
